Use Built-in Tools To Scan Your Mac For Malware
Every Mac comes with aMilitary antivirus products. macOS contains technology known as XProtect, which scans your Mac for malware using a virus database provided by Apple to look for signatures. This is enabled by default, so you don’t need to do anything to use it. If you download your own software or adware and try to run them, XProtect detects them and prevents them from running.
But XProtect is better than nothing, but it also has some important limitations. Apple does not deal with specialized security, which is why XProtect does not detect as many bacteria as Dedicated Security. XProtect is a great passive solution. You cannot run a custom scan to check your Mac for spyware and.
Check Activity Monitor For Mac Malware
If you think your Mac is infected with a virus, one of the best places to eat is Activity Monitor. Here you can see background processes and applications running with them, including trojans.
2. Go to the CPU tab, otherwise you are already there
3. Click on a specific column “% CPU” to sort by count and find your CPU usage
4. If you see a suspicious process, do a Google search. You should find information that does not confirm or is malware

Look At Your Login Items
Malware is often downloaded automatically when our Mac starts up. So be sure to keep this in mind in your macOS Login Items list. However, keep in mind that many login elements like LaunchDaemons and LaunchAgents are They are not displayed in the list. Therefore, you may have to go further to find it.
